The staff appear completely unable to control the scammers and fraud artists. If Zero stars was an option; that’s the rating I would give.
Best Reviewed Businesses
Subscribe to Blog via Email
Join 10.1K other subscribers
The staff appear completely unable to control the scammers and fraud artists. If Zero stars was an option; that’s the rating I would give.